Named: Twin Peaks (Broads Fork side) There are actually two sets of Twin Peaks in the Wasatch. These are the “Broads Fork” Twin Peaks, overlooking the Salt Lake Valley. About: “Broads Fork” Twin Peaks are 11,330 feet tall, the second highest in Salt Lake County. Standing atop either …

WebHike to the highest point in the state of Utah! This trail starts at the Henry’s Fork trailhead at the end of County Road 224 and goes past Dollar Lake, near Henry's Fork Lake, and over Gunsight Pass (11,891 feet). It then drops down into the Upper Painter Basin about 2 miles to a trail junction. Turn right and climb 3.5 miles to Anderson Pass (12,800 feet). From …
